Welcome to Forensic Friday where we examine the intersection of true crime, psychology and the heart of being human in the middle of it all. Jeannine Anderson, MA, LPC, LAC, DVCS and Natalie Halcomb, MA, LPC, DVCS Apprentice are a dynamic duo providing forensic services to clients all along the front range in Colorado. Both specialize in risk assessment, psychopathy, trauma, relationships, and motivational interviewing.   • Predators Next Door: The Murder of Alexis Rasmussen and the Call for Vigilance
    2026/06/12

    It started with a babysitting gig in North Ogden, but behind the closed doors of the Millerberg home, a sinister cycle of grooming was already in motion. This week, we examine the tragic 2011 death of 16-year-old Alexis Rasmussen. We dissect the drug-fueled abuse that led to her overdose, the shocking decision by the perpetrators to dump her body like 'trash,' and the legal battle that eventually put Eric Millerberg behind bars. We also take a hard look at the role of his wife, Dea Millerberg—her complicity, her trial, and the debate over how much culpability a partner bears in a crime they helped cover up.
